STS Technical Services is hiring an Aircraft Quality Assurance InspectorinChattanooga,Tennessee.
Overview:This position which provides support to the Quality Assurance department requires strong organization and attention to detail; intermediate to advanced knowledge of Word, Outlook, Excel, PowerPoint, and strong telephone skills. The job duties will vary each day. Work with Program Managers, Leads and Quality Control Inspectors to ensure accurate and customer oriented service. Update maintenance tracking system from log entries for all maintenance and modifications to aircraft assigned. Assist the Quality Manager in completing all FAA approval and return to service paperwork as required to support the facility operations. Insure quality control and release of aircraft meet company and FAA requirements.
